天翼云代理商:如何利用天翼云弹性伸缩,实现我的应用零停机维护和升级?

2025-10-21 08:39:04 编辑:admin 阅读:
导读天翼云代理商指南:如何利用天翼云弹性伸缩实现应用零停机维护与升级 一、理解零停机维护与升级的核心需求 零停机维护和升级是指在系统运行过程中,通过技术手段确保业务持续可用,用户无感知的情况下完成版本迭代

天翼云代理商指南:如何利用天翼云弹性伸缩实现应用零停机维护与升级

一、理解零停机维护与升级的核心需求

零停机维护和升级是指在系统运行过程中,通过技术手段确保业务持续可用,用户无感知的情况下完成版本迭代或资源调整。这对高可用性要求严格的金融、政务、电商等领域尤为重要。天翼云弹性伸缩服务通过自动化资源调度和负载均衡能力,为代理商提供了实现这一目标的技术基础。

二、天翼云弹性伸缩的核心优势

1. 智能化的资源自动扩缩容

天翼云弹性伸缩(Auto Scaling)可根据预设的CPU使用率、内存负载等指标自动增加或减少ECS实例,在维护期间自动补充新节点,确保业务流量无缝切换。其动态阈值调整算法比传统云服务响应速度提升40%。

2. 与负载均衡的深度集成

弹性伸缩组天然对接天翼云负载均衡(SLB),新实例启动后自动注册到SLB,下线实例自动注销。结合健康检查机制,可实现请求的智能分流,这是实现蓝绿部署的关键。

3. 多可用区高可用架构

天翼云在全国部署了8大资源池,支持跨可用区实例分布。当某个可用区进行维护时,弹性伸缩可自动将实例调度到其他可用区,从基础设施层保障连续性。

三、零停机升级的具体实施方案

1. 蓝绿部署模式

步骤1: 创建双倍容量的伸缩组(蓝组+绿组),初始流量全部指向蓝组
步骤2: 在绿组部署新版本并完成测试验证
步骤3: 通过SLB权重调整逐步将流量切至绿组
关键点: 结合天翼云API网关的流量镜像功能,可先进行影子测试

2. 滚动更新策略

操作流程:
1) 配置伸缩组的实例刷新策略为"滚动更新"
2) 设置每次替换20%实例的批次间隔为5分钟
3) 新实例启动后自动加载最新镜像
4) 旧实例在确认无流量后自动销毁
优势: 资源消耗仅为蓝绿部署的1.2倍,适用于中小规模应用

3. 数据库层面的配合方案

结合天翼云RDS的读写分离功能:
- 应用升级前先升级备库并切换为只读模式测试
- 通过DTS数据同步确保主备库数据一致性
- 最终通过控制台一键完成主备切换(切换时间<30秒)

四、运维监控保障体系

1. 全链路监控配置

需配置三层次监控:
1) 基础设施层: 云监控服务跟踪CPU/内存/磁盘指标
2) 应用层: 使用APM监控JVM/HTTP请求成功率
3) 业务层: 自定义订单创建等关键事务监控

2. 告警自动响应机制

建议设置:
- 当HTTP 500错误率>0.1%时自动触发回滚
- 平均响应时间>2秒时自动扩容20%实例
- 通过云助手自动执行预设的故障修复脚本

3. 日志审计与复盘

利用天翼云日志服务(CTS)记录所有API操作,特别是:
- 伸缩组配置变更记录
- 负载均衡权重调整历史
- 数据库切换时间戳
便于升级后的问题追溯和效能分析

五、典型客户场景实践

案例1:政务服务平台季度升级

某省级政务云在社保系统升级时:
1) 采用蓝绿部署模式,在凌晨2点完成切换
2) 利用天翼云CDN预热新版本静态资源
3) 最终实现服务中断时间为0,相比传统方式节省3小时维护窗口

案例2:电商大促弹性保障

某跨境电商的双11预案:
1) 预设5套伸缩规则应对不同流量级别
2) 结合预测性伸缩提前10分钟扩容
3) 活动期间自动完成12次扩容/缩容操作
4) 节省闲置资源成本约35%

总结

作为天翼云代理商,帮助客户实现零停机维护需要充分发挥弹性伸缩的核心能力,结合蓝绿部署、滚动更新等策略,构建包括资源调度、流量管理、数据同步在内的完整技术方案。通过本文介绍的实施方案,代理商可以:1)显著提升客户系统可用性等级,2)将传统4小时维护窗口压缩至分钟级,3)通过自动化降低运维人力成本。建议结合具体业务场景,选择适当的升级策略,并充分利用天翼云监控告警体系保障操作安全。后续可进一步探索与容器服务、Serverless等技术的结合,构建更敏捷的持续交付体系。

温馨提示: 需要上述业务或相关服务,请加客服QQ【582059487】或点击网站在线咨询,与我们沟通。

版权说明 本站部分内容来自互联网,仅用于信息分享和传播,内容如有侵权,请联系本站删除!转载请保留金推网原文链接,并在文章开始或结尾处标注“文章来源:金推网”, 腾讯云11·11优惠券/阿里云11·11优惠券
相关阅读
最新发布
热门阅读